v. Obs. [Imitative of the sound: cf. BOW-WOW.] To bark, as a dog.
1576. Fleming, trans. Caius Dogs, in Arb., Garner, III. 255. Bawing and wawing at the moon.
1639. Horn & Robotham, Gate Lang. Unl., xv. § 187. If you smite him, he yelpeth
and baughs.
